If you are interested in similar rug patterns, rugs from the Kerman or Tabriz regions may also pique your interest. These rugs are characterized by elaborate and often floral patterns that are decorated in vibrant colors. Kerman rugs are known for their high knot count and exquisite materials, while Tabriz rugs impress with traditional motifs and robust workmanship. In addition, manufacturers such as Nain and Isfahan are also known for their outstanding quality. Nain rugs often combine wool with silk and feature detailed, geometric patterns, while Isfahan rugs are prized for their ornate depictions and fine workmanship. These rugs are perfect alternatives that also reflect the charm and elegance of Middle Eastern weaving. If you want to furnish your rooms with an exceptional carpet, you should also take a look at the different styles and patterns from the Ghazvin region. These are characterized by traditional motifs and an excellent color palette. FAQ about Middle Eastern rugs How do I properly care for my Middle Eastern carpet? To preserve the beauty of your Middle Eastern rug, vacuum it regularly and have it professionally cleaned when necessary. Avoid direct sunlight to prevent the colors from fading. Where do the best Middle Eastern rugs come from? The best Middle Eastern rugs come from regions such as Kerman, Tabriz, Nain and Isfahan. Each region has its own distinctive patterns and colors that give the rugs their unique charm. How do I recognize the quality of a Middle Eastern carpet? The quality of a Middle Eastern rug can be recognized by the number of knots per square meter, the materials used and the fineness of the patterns. High-quality rugs have a high knot count and first-class materials such as wool and silk.
